Ingredients You’ll Need
All the ingredients for this Sheet Pan Sausage Dinner Recipe are straightforward and accessible, but each one plays a crucial role in creating that irresistible combo of taste, aroma, and texture. From the juicy sausage to the crisp bell peppers and subtly spiced seasonings, every component matters.
- 12 ounces sausage (sliced into 1/2-inch rounds): Choose your favorite variety—spicy or mild, pork or chicken—to bring hearty flavor and protein to the dish.
- 1/2 red onion (sliced): Adds a mild sweetness and soft texture that complements the sausage beautifully.
- 1 red bell pepper (sliced): Brings vibrant color and a subtle fruity note that brightens the plate.
- 1 orange bell pepper (sliced): Along with the red pepper, it adds a lovely pop of color and juicy crunch.
- 1 zucchini (cut into 1/4-inch half moons): Offers a tender, slightly earthy contrast that makes the dish feel fresh and balanced.
- 2 tablespoons olive oil: Helps everything roast evenly and locks in moisture while adding a silky richness.
- 1 teaspoon paprika: Provides a smoky warmth that enhances the sausage and veggies.
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der: Adds depth and a savory boost without overpowering the natural flavors.
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der: Reinforces the onion’s sweet notes for a more rounded seasoning.
- 1/2 teaspoon salt: Pulls all the flavors together and enhances their natural qualities.
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per: Gives the dish a gentle kick of heat and complexity.
How to Make Sheet Pan Sausage Dinner Recipe
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
First things first, set your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. This temperature is perfect for roasting the sausage and vegetables to a tender and caramelized finish, ensuring everything cooks through evenly and quickly.
Step 2: Toss Ingredients on the Sheet Pan
Place all the sliced sausage, red onion, red and orange bell peppers, and zucchini on a large sheet pan. Drizzle the olive oil over the top. Then, use your hands or a spatula to toss everything together until the sausage and veggies are lightly coated in the oil. This step makes sure every bite is full of flavor and doesn’t dry out during roasting.
Step 3: Season Generously
Sprinkle pa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and black pepper evenly over the sausage and vegetables. Give everything a gentle toss again to spread the seasonings well. Then, spread the mixture into a single layer to promote even cooking and prevent steaming, which keeps the veggies nicely roasted.
Step 4: Roast Until Tender
Place the sheet pan in your preheated oven and roast for about 20 minutes. The vegetables should be tender and slightly caramelized around the edges while the sausage cooks through and develops a golden crust. Keep an eye on it near the end to make sure nothing burns and everything reaches that perfect roasted state.
Step 5: Serve Immediately
The beauty of this Sheet Pan Sausage Dinner Recipe is it shines best fresh from the oven while everything is warm and bursting with flavor. Serve it straight from the pan, or pair it with a side of fluffy rice to make it a heartier, more filling meal.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
If you happen to have le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They will keep well for up to 3 to 4 days. The veggies may soften more, but the flavors will remain vibrant and make for an easy next-day meal.
Freezing
This recipe freezes beautifully, which makes it great for batch cooking. Let the sausage and veggies cool completely, then pack into freezer-safe containers or bags. It will stay fresh up to 3 months. Just th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.
Reheating
To reheat, you can use a microwave for convenience, but for the best texture, reheat in a 350-degree Fahrenheit oven for about 10 minutes. This will bring back some crispness to the sausage and veggies without drying them out.
FAQs
Can I use a different type of sausage in this Sheet Pan Sausage Dinner Recipe?
Absolutely! Feel free to swap in Italian sausage, chicken sausage, or even plant-based sausage depending on your taste and dietary preferences. Each will lend its own unique flavor to the dish.
What vegetables work best besides the ones listed?
This recipe is very flexible. You can add chopped potatoes, asparagus, cherry tomatoes, or even mushrooms. Just be mindful of cooking times and cut veggies to similar sizes so everything cooks evenly.
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, this Sheet Pan Sausage Dinner Recipe is naturally gluten-free as long as you choose sausage and seasonings without any gluten-containing ingredients. Always check labels if you’re unsure.
How can I make this dish spicier?
To add some heat, choose spicy sausage or sprinkle in cayenne pepper or chili powder with the other seasonings. You can also serve it with hot sauce on the side for individual control.
Can I prepare this recipe in advance?
You can prep the sausage and chop the veggies ahead of time, then keep them refrigerated until ready to roast. However, it’s best to bake and serve the dish fresh for optimal flavor and texture.

Ingredients
Sausage and Vegetables
- 12 ounces sausage, sliced into 1/2-inch rounds
- 1/2 red onion, sliced
- 1 red bell pepper, sliced
- 1 orange bell pepper, sliced
- 1 zucchini, cut into 1/4-inch half moons
Seasonings and Oil
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
- Preheat the oven. Preheat your oven to 400°F (204°C) to ensure it reaches the right temperature for roasting the sausage and vegetables.
- Prepare ingredients on the sheet pan. Toss the sliced sausage, red onion, red and orange bell peppers, and olive oil together on a large sheet pan to evenly coat everything with oil.
- Season the mixture. Sprinkle pa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and black pepper over the sausage and vegetables. Spread the mixture into a single, even layer on the pan for thorough cooking.
- Bake until tender. Place the sheet pan in the oven and bake for 20 minutes or until the vegetables are tender and the sausage is cooked through with a slight caramelization.
- Serve. Remove from oven and serve immediately. For a heartier meal, consider pairing the sausage and veggies with cooked rice.
Notes
- Use pre-cooked sausage for quicker preparation; if using raw sausage, ensure it’s fully cooked before serving.
- Feel free to swap bell peppers with other vegetables like asparagus or broccoli based on preference.
- Adjust seasonings to taste, adding chili flakes for extra heat if desired.
- Line the sheet pan with foil or parchment paper for easier cleanup.
- This dish pairs well with rice, quinoa, or crusty bread for a complete meal.
